Incorrect Oven Temperature
The temperature of the oven is a critical factor in baking cookies. If the oven is too hot, the cookies will spread too much before they have a chance to set, resulting in a blob-like shape. Conversely, an oven that is too cool may not provide enough heat for the cookies to bake properly, leading to undercooked or misshapen cookies. It’s essential to use an oven thermometer to ensure the oven is at the correct temperature, as the dial on the oven may not always be accurate.
Insufficient Cooling of the Baking Sheet
Failing to cool the baking sheet between batches can cause the butter in the cookie dough to melt too quickly, leading to excessive spreading and blob-like cookies. Allowing the baking sheet to cool or using a new sheet for each batch can help prevent this issue.
Overmixing the Dough
Overmixing the cookie dough can lead to the development of gluten in the flour, causing the cookies to become tough and spread too much during baking. It’s important to mix the ingredients just until they come together in a cohesive dough, avoiding overmixing.

Importance of Resting the Dough
Resting the cookie dough, or letting it chill in the refrigerator, can significantly improve the texture and appearance of the baked cookies. This process allows the flour to fully hydrate, which can help the cookies to retain their shape during baking. Additionally, chilling the dough can help to reduce spreading, resulting in cookies that are more rounded and less blob-like.
Using the Right Baking Sheet
The type of baking sheet used can also impact the outcome of the cookies. Light-colored baking sheets are preferable, as they absorb less heat than dark sheets, which can cause the cookies to bake too quickly and spread excessively. Additionally, lining the baking sheet with parchment paper can help to prevent the cookies from spreading too much and make them easier to remove once baked.

How does the type of sugar used affect the texture of cookies?
The type of sugar used in cookie dough can significantly impact the texture of the final product. White granulated sugar, for example, produces a crispy cookie with a tender center, while brown sugar produces a chewier cookie with a richer flavor. This is because brown sugar contains more moisture than white sugar, which helps to keep the cookies soft and chewy. On the other hand, using confectioner’s sugar can result in a cookie that is too delicate and prone to breaking. The type of sugar used can also affect the spread of the cookies, with white sugar producing a more spread-out cookie and brown sugar producing a cookie that retains its shape.
The choice of sugar also depends on the type of cookie being made. For example, if you’re making a classic chocolate chip cookie, white granulated sugar is usually the best choice. However, if you’re making a cookie that requires a richer flavor, such as a gingerbread cookie, brown sugar may be a better option. It’s also worth noting that using a combination of different types of sugar can produce a unique texture and flavor. For instance, using a combination of white and brown sugar can produce a cookie that is both crispy and chewy. By experimenting with different types of sugar, you can find the perfect combination to achieve the texture and flavor you’re looking for in your cookies.

How does the temperature of the butter affect the texture of cookies?
The temperature of the butter used in cookie dough can significantly impact the texture of the final product. When butter is at room temperature, it is soft and pliable, which allows it to cream easily with sugar and produce a cookie that is light and tender. However, if the butter is too warm, it can cause the cookies to spread too much and become tough. On the other hand, if the butter is too cold, it can cause the cookies to be dense and hard. The ideal temperature for butter is around 72°F to 76°F (22°C to 24°C), which allows it to cream easily with sugar and produce a cookie that is both tender and chewy.
The temperature of the butter can also affect the structure of the cookies. When butter is at the right temperature, it can help to create a cookie that has a delicate balance of crunch and chew. However, if the butter is too warm or too cold, it can disrupt this balance and produce a cookie that is either too hard or too soft. To ensure that your butter is at the right temperature, it’s essential to take it out of the refrigerator and let it sit at room temperature for at least 30 minutes before using it. You can also use a thermometer to check the temperature of the butter and ensure that it’s within the ideal range. By controlling the temperature of the butter, you can produce cookies that have the perfect texture and structure.
Can I use a convection oven to bake cookies?
Yes, you can use a convection oven to bake cookies, but it’s essential to adjust the temperature and baking time to ensure the best results. Convection ovens use a fan to circulate hot air around the cookies, which can help to bake them more evenly and quickly. However, this can also cause the cookies to spread too much and become tough. To prevent this, it’s recommended to reduce the oven temperature by 25°F (15°C) and to bake the cookies for a shorter amount of time. You can also use the convection setting to bake multiple batches of cookies at once, which can help to increase efficiency and productivity.
When using a convection oven to bake cookies, it’s crucial to keep an eye on them to ensure that they don’t overcook. Convection ovens can bake cookies quickly, so it’s essential to check on them frequently to prevent them from becoming too dark or crispy. You can also use a thermometer to ensure that the oven is at the correct temperature, which can help to produce cookies that are consistently baked. Additionally, using a convection oven can help to produce cookies that are crispy on the outside and chewy on the inside, which can be a desirable texture for many types of cookies. By adjusting the temperature and baking time, you can use a convection oven to produce perfectly baked cookies that are both delicious and visually appealing.
How do I store cookies to keep them fresh for a longer period?
To keep cookies fresh for a longer period, it’s essential to store them in an airtight container at room temperature. This can help to prevent moisture and air from reaching the cookies, which can cause them to become stale or soft. You can also store cookies in the refrigerator or freezer to keep them fresh for a longer period. When storing cookies in the refrigerator, it’s recommended to place them in an airtight container or plastic bag to prevent them from absorbing odors and moisture. When storing cookies in the freezer, it’s recommended to place them in a single layer on a baking sheet and then transfer them to an airtight container or plastic bag.
The type of cookie being stored can also affect the storage method. For example, delicate cookies such as sugar cookies or snickerdoodles are best stored in an airtight container at room temperature, while heartier cookies such as chocolate chip or oatmeal raisin can be stored in the refrigerator or freezer. It’s also important to note that cookies can absorb odors and flavors from other foods, so it’s essential to store them separately from strong-smelling foods.
